Q: Is 9,716,189 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 9,716,189 is a composite number.

Why is 9,716,189 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 9,716,189 can be evenly divided by 1 7 23 29 161 203 667 2,081 4,669 14,567 47,863 60,349 335,041 422,443 1,388,027 and 9,716,189, with no remainder.

Since 9,716,189 cannot be divided by just 1 and 9,716,189, it is a composite number.
